The mighty Nile: cradle of life and civilization - and a powerful source of fame and fortune.
In Egizia, players sail ships carrying workers and stone to build mighty monuments for the Pharaoh. The river offers great rewards and abilities as it flows ever Northward to the sea.
And therein lies the challenge.
Each ship must be placed downriver from your last. When you sail past a space, there's no going back.

Egizia Rio Grande | Stronghold Games | BGG
Designer: Acchittocca (which is a pseudonym for these four Italian deisgners: Flaminia Brasini, Virginio Gigli, Stefano Luperto & Antonio Tinto)
Publisher: Rio Grande Games, Stronghold Games (new edition)
2-4 players 90 min ages 12+ MSRP $40
Stronghold Games is publishing an updated version of Egizia in 2019! The new edition is Egizia: Shifting Sands. We'll include a link to more information on the upcoming crowdfunding campaign when it is available.
